Box ScoreGRAND JUNCTION, Colo. - The Colorado Mesa women's basketball team suffered a 70-59 loss to the CSU-Pueblo Thunderwolves Friday at Brownson Arena. The Mavericks dropped to 11-7 overall and 8-6 in the RMAC.
Â
Colorado Mesa led 36-33 at half but trailed by as much as 10 points in the fourth. They cut the Thunderwolves lead to five after a three-pointer by
Jaylyn Duran, but the Mavericks would only score three more points to finish the game.
Â
The Mavericks finished the game shooting 19-of-54 from the field and 8-of-16 from the free throw line. Colorado Mesa was also outscored 26-8 on points in the paint.
Â
Colorado Mesa got into foul trouble with four of their players committing 3 or more fouls during the game, which led to the Thunderwolves shooting eight more free throws than the Mavericks.
Â
Ashley Stevens led the Mavericks with 11 points, while
Sydney Small finished with 10 points on 3-of-5 shooting from the field and 3-of-3 at the three-point line.
Â
Siu Lo'amanu also finished the game with 10 points while
Shyanne Halalilo chipped in eight points and a team-high six rebounds.
Â
Tuileisu Anderson scored 17 points and had five rebounds for the CSU-Pueblo Thunderwolves.
